A Rare Opportunity in a Premier Coastal Setting – St Brelade’s Bay

Occupying an exceptional position overlooking the golden sands and turquoise waters of the highly sought-after St Brelade’s Bay, this imposing granite residence offers a once-in-a-generation opportunity to acquire a substantial home on one of Jersey’s most exclusive coastlines.

Set behind a gated entrance and approached via a sweeping driveway, the property sits on a generous and private plot, providing both seclusion and serenity while remaining close to the vibrant amenities of St Brelade. Originally built in the 1970s, the residence spans an impressive 13,000 sq ft and stands as a testament to the quality craftsmanship of its era. Its classic granite façade, mature gardens, and commanding elevated position offer timeless curb appeal, while the scale and configuration of the property lend themselves to both luxurious modernisation or a complete reimagining—subject to the usual planning permissions.

The heart of the home is its extraordinary indoor swimming pool complex, a rare feature that offers year-round leisure and entertainment potential. With expansive glazing, and access to terraced areas and gardens, the pool area is a standout space that echoes the grandeur and scale found throughout the residence.

The property’s layout is generously proportioned, with multiple reception rooms, extensive bedroom suites, and flexible spaces that could be transformed into state-of-the-art home cinemas, wellness areas, or additional guest accommodation. Floor-to-ceiling windows and strategically positioned balconies make full use of the property’s most prized asset: the breathtaking, uninterrupted views over St Brelade’s Bay. Sunsets here are truly spectacular, casting golden light across the bay and creating a dramatic backdrop to this already striking home.

Outside, the grounds are substantial and well established, offering ample scope for landscaped gardens, outdoor entertaining areas, as well as a fabulous Tennis Court and scope for further extension. The elevated position not only provides panoramic sea views but also ensures the utmost privacy. The gated entrance and long driveway reinforce the sense of exclusivity and arrival, while ample parking and garaging offer convenience for a modern family lifestyle.

This property represents a rare chance to secure one of the largest and most impressively situated homes on the south west coast of Jersey. Whether you choose to restore and modernise the existing structure or embark on a visionary redevelopment project, the potential here is truly extraordinary. Properties of this scale and prominence, with such enviable views and grounds, seldom come to market.
